'Needs to play a back pass' - Hull City manager blames Ajayi for costly error in loss to Derby
Published: November 05, 2025
Hull City manager Sergej Jakirović has criticised Nigerian defender Semi Ajayi for his role in the late goal that condemned the Tigers to a 2-1 defeat against Derby County on Tuesday night.
The 48-year-old tactician expressed disappointment over the mix-up between Ajayi and goalkeeper Ivor Pandur, which allowed Derby's Lars-Jorgen Salvesen to score the winning goal in the final seven minutes at Pride Park.
Speaking during his post match reaction, Jakirović frowned at the incident, insisting that Ajayi should have played a back pass to the goalkeeper to avoid the costly error.
"In my opinion Semi (Ajayi) needs to play a back pass and Ivor (Pandur) must stay in his box because Semi is closer to the ball and I have watched the video," Jakirović said, as quoted by Bordertelegraph.
"But it's a misunderstanding and he tried to clear the ball but he missed."
Semi Ajayi joined the Tigers in the summer as a free agent after his contract with West Brom expired.
The former Arsenal defender quickly established himself as a key figure in Hull City's backline, putting in a commanding display that helped the team secure a goalless draw away at Coventry on the opening day of the season.
However, a hamstring injury disrupted his momentum and has since affected his form.
Since returning from the setback, Ajayi has struggled to reach his previous high standards.
As Hull prepare to face Portsmouth, the Nigerian defender will be eager to move past his recent error and regain the form that once made him a defensive pillar for the Tigers.
